Steve Kerr
American basketball player and coach

2024 | Steve Kerr was selected as the head coach for the USA Basketball team for the 2024 Olympics where they are expected to compete for a Gold Medal. |
2024 | Kerr coached the U.S. Team to its fifth consecutive gold medal at the Summer Olympic Men's Basketball Tournament, defeating host country France in the final. |

August 19 2024 | Steve Kerr spoke at the 2024 Democratic National Convention. |

2023 | Steve Kerr bought a minority stake in the soccer club Mallorca. |
2023 | Steve Kerr served as the head coach for the United States men's national basketball team, leading the team to a successful tournament with a record of 10 wins and 3 losses. |
2023 | In the 2022–23 season, Steve Kerr and the Golden State Warriors reached the Western Conference Semifinals, where they were defeated in six games by the Los Angeles Lakers. |
2023 | Kerr portrayed a cartoon version of himself on the animated series Clone High, acting as the judge of a fictitious reality show called Tropical Hospital. |

2022 | Steve Kerr was named one of the Top 15 Coaches in NBA History during the NBA's 75th anniversary celebration. |
2022 | Under Steve Kerr's leadership, the Golden State Warriors won the ESPY Award for Outstanding Team. |
2022 | Steve Kerr won his fourth NBA championship as a head coach of the Golden State Warriors. |

May 24 2022 | During a press conference for Game 4 of the NBA's 2022 Western Conference finals, Steve Kerr emotionally spoke out on gun control in response to the Robb Elementary School shooting. |

December 2021 | Steve Kerr was named head coach of the United States men's basketball team. |

2020 | Steve Kerr served as an assistant coach for the USA Basketball team that won the Olympic Gold Medal. |

October 27 2020 | Steve Kerr, alongside Philadelphia 76ers coach Doc Rivers, endorsed Joe Biden for president in an advertisement created by the Lincoln Project Super PAC. |

2019 | The Warriors reached their fifth consecutive NBA Finals under Kerr but were defeated by the Toronto Raptors in six games. |
2019 | Patrick McCaw, a player coached by Steve Kerr with the Warriors, achieved the same milestone as Kerr by winning three championships with two different teams in consecutive seasons. |
2019 | During Game 5 of the 2019 Finals, Kevin Durant tore his Achilles, and in Game 6, Klay Thompson tore his ACL. |

2018 | Steve Kerr won his third NBA championship as a head coach of the Golden State Warriors. |

2017 | Under Steve Kerr's leadership, the Golden State Warriors won the ESPY Award for Outstanding Team. |
2017 | Steve Kerr won his second NBA championship as a head coach of the Golden State Warriors. |
2017 | Kerr returned as head coach for Game 2 of the 2017 NBA Finals, where the Warriors defeated the Cleveland Cavaliers in a five-game series. |
2017 | Kerr missed time during the 2017 playoffs due to recurring back issues, with associate head coach Mike Brown taking over and leading the Warriors to a perfect 13–0 record in the postseason. |

2016 | The 2015–16 Warriors broke the record for the most wins in an NBA season by winning 73 games. |
2016 | Kerr led the Warriors to the 2016 NBA Finals, where they faced the Cleveland Cavaliers but lost the series in seven games after leading 3–1. |
2016 | Steve Kerr was named the NBA Coach of the Year. |
